Episode 142 Mount Ebal Curse Tablet with Scott Stripling

The Mount Ebal Curse Tablet is a small folded lead tablet. If dated properly, it's the first reference to the name of Israel’s God in the archaeological record. The post Episode 142 Mount Ebal Curse Tablet with Scott Stripling first appeared on Lanier Theological Library.
